Log:
2008-03-10  Dan Williams  <dcbw redhat com>

	* src/nm-cdma-device.c
		- (do_dial, init_modem): handle errors from
			nm_serial_device_send_command_string()

	* src/nm-gsm-device.c
		- (do_dial, manual_registration, automatic_registration_get_network,
		   automatic_registration, enter_pin, check_pin, init_modem): handle
			errors from nm_serial_device_send_command_string()
